Technical Specifications
Side-by-side comparison of EPYC 9565 and EPYC 9684X

EPYC 9565
The EPYC 9565 is manufactured by AMD. It was released in 10 October 2024 (1 year ago). It is based on the Turin (2024) architecture. It features 72 cores and 144 threads. Base frequency is 3.15 GHz, with boost up to 4.3 GHz. L3 cache: 384 MB (total). L2 cache: 1 MB (per core). Built on 4 nm process technology. Socket: SP5. Thermal design power (TDP): 400 Watt. Memory support: DDR5. Passmark benchmark score: 135,221 points. Launch price was $10,486.

EPYC 9684X
The EPYC 9684X is manufactured by AMD. It was released in 13 June 2023 (2 years ago). It is based on the Genoa-X (2023) architecture. It features 96 cores and 192 threads. Base frequency is 2.55 GHz, with boost up to 3.7 GHz. L3 cache: 1152 MB (total). L2 cache: 1 MB (per core). Built on 5 nm process technology. Socket: SP5. Thermal design power (TDP): 400 Watt. Memory support: DDR5. Passmark benchmark score: 122,017 points. Launch price was $14,756.
Processing Power
The EPYC 9565 packs 72 cores / 144 threads, while the EPYC 9684X offers 96 cores / 192 threads — the EPYC 9684X has 24 more cores. Boost clocks reach 4.3 GHz on the EPYC 9565 versus 3.7 GHz on the EPYC 9684X — a 15% clock advantage for the EPYC 9565 (base: 3.15 GHz vs 2.55 GHz). The EPYC 9565 uses the Turin (2024) architecture (4 nm), while the EPYC 9684X uses Genoa-X (2023) (5 nm). In PassMark, the EPYC 9565 scores 135,221 against the EPYC 9684X's 122,017 — a 10.3% lead for the EPYC 9565. L3 cache: 384 MB (total) on the EPYC 9565 vs 1152 MB (total) on the EPYC 9684X.
